目录

  1、基于windows平台的mysql项目场景

  2、mysql数据库运行环境准备

  3、下载mysql

  4、通过Installer方式(即msi方式)安装mysql

  5、卸载mysql

————————————————————————————————————

1、基于windows平台的mysql项目场景

  【1】小型购物网站  【2】中小型论坛  【3】中小型门户

  【4】博客系统    【5】IDC/云平台/虚拟主机

2、mysql数据库运行环境准备
  2.1、可以去官方查看要求:https://www.mysql.com/support/supportedplatforms/database.html

  2.2、准备一个虚拟机,准备空间

  2.3、装一个winodws server 2008 R2

  2.4、进行一些OS配置,修改主机名,HOSTS文件名(C:\Windows\System32\drivers\etc\hosts),设置IP

  2.5、如果是安装版本,还要安装一些操作系统基本的组件,如 .net framework、vc++ 2013 32+64、vc++ 2015

  2.6、开始动手下载mysql,安装

3、下载mysql

  MSI:https://dev.mysql.com/downloads/windows/installer/5.7.html

  ZIP:https://dev.mysql.com/downloads/mysql/5.7.html#downloads

  安装办法:

    MSI:常规MSI(仅服务器版本:https://www.cnblogs.com/gered/p/9536512.html

    MSI:官网安装版本(即上面给的下载链接下载的安装包:https://www.cnblogs.com/zjiacun/p/6653891.html

    ZIP: 解压直接使用安装方式(即上面给的下载链接下载的ZIP文件:https://www.cnblogs.com/gered/p/9537762.html

4、通过Installer方式(即msi方式)安装mysql

    MSI:官网安装版本(即上面给的下载链接下载的安装包:https://www.cnblogs.com/zjiacun/p/6653891.html

    使用custom 自定义安装

  4.1、安装完成后停服,改目录,设置环境变量

  4.2、准备My.ini配置文件,并且设置好参数

  4.3、重新初始化Mysql数据库(这里只是示例,具体按自己的安装目录而定)

    mysqld --defaults-file = 'e:\mysql\data\my.ini'  --initialize  --basedir='e:\mysql\mysql57' --datadir='e:mysql\data\data'  (可以从错误日志里面找默认密码)

  4.4、启动停止日志,初始化参数内容(根据my.ini中的配置,查看错误日志与缓存日志)

  4.5、后期配置及连接测试

    【1】改密码  【2】启用远程登录  

    【3】创建数据库测试  

    ————————————————————————————

    【1】改密码

      用root登录mysql,然后desc mysql.user,找到对应字段

      Create_tablespace_priv;

      然后直接

        update mysql.user set Create_tablespace_priv=password("123456") where user="root";

        flush privileges;

      或者可以这样改  

        Alter user 'root'@'locahost' inentified by 'MyNewPass!';

    【2】启用远程登录

      (1)设置iptables开放3306端口

      vi /etc/sysconfig/iptables

    

      

      (2)localhost改成%,否则就只能localhost本地访问(或者可以新建一个host为%的root用户)    

#修改

mysql -u root -p

mysql>use mysql;

mysql>update user set host ='%' where user ='root';

mysql>flush privileges;

#新建(详情见:登录及账户权限设置
 create user test1@'%' identified by '123456';
 #mysql中用户的形式就是 用户名@主机名,这里主机名位置写的%,代表任意IP都可以连。
#也可以这样
grant all privileges on *.* to 'root'@'%' identified by '123456';
flush privileges;
 
 

  【3】建表、建用户

  (详情见:登录及账户权限设置
  

5、卸载mysql

  5.1 MSI方式

  【1】停止服务  【2】用mysql安装时自带的卸载组件(mysql installer - community)

  5.2 ZIP

  【1】mysqld -remove mysql_server     移除Mysql服务,mysql_server就是服务名,要根据自己的情况修改

  【2】清除环境变量  【3】删除mysql所有目录

(0.1)windows下的mysql配置使用步骤的更多相关文章

  1. RPM方式安装MySQL5.6和windows下安装mysql解压版

    下载地址: http://cdn.MySQL.com/archives/mysql-5.6/MySQL-server-5.6.13-1.el6.x86_64.rpmhttp://cdn.mysql.c ...

  2. Windows 下用 gogs 配置局域网 git server

    大道曙光 Windows 下用 gogs 配置局域网 git server 最近要用 C# 开发一个新的项目,所以需要在 Windows 局域网环境下构建一个 git server. 在 Window ...

  3. Windows下搭建MySQL Master Slave[转]

    Windows下搭建MySQL Master Slave 一.背景 服务器上放了很多MySQL数据库,为了安全,现在需要做Master/Slave方案,因为操作系统是Window的,所以没有办法使用k ...

  4. Windows下安装MySQL详细教程

    Windows下安装MySQL详细教程 1.安装包下载  2.安装教程 (1)配置环境变量 (2)生成data文件 (3)安装MySQL (4)启动服务 (5)登录MySQL (6)查询用户密码 (7 ...

  5. MySQL8.0在Windows下的安装和使用

    前言 MySQL在Windows下有2种安装方式:1.图形化界面方式安装MySQL 2.noinstall方式安装MySQL.在这里,本文只介绍第二种方式:以noinstall方式安装MySQL,以及 ...

  6. Windows 下修改 MySQL 编码为 utf8

    问题 Windows 下安装 MySQL 后,默认编码不全utf8. mysql> show variables like '%char%'; +------------------------ ...

  7. Windows下安装mysql(非安装包)

    Windows下安装mysql(非安装包) 参考:https://www.cnblogs.com/yunlongaimeng/p/12558638.html 1.下载MYSQL(慢的话可以用迅雷,或其 ...

  8. Windows下python的配置

    Windows下python的配置 希望这是最后一次写关于python的配置博客了,已经被python的安装烦的不行了.一开始我希望安装python.手动配置pip并使用pip安装numpy,然而发现 ...

  9. windows下安装mysql笔记

    接着上几篇文章再来看下windows下安装mysql. 我这里是windows7 64位, 安装过程中还是遇到一些坑,这里记录下. 一.下载安装包 打开mysql官网下载页面:http://dev.m ...

随机推荐

  1. jquery-alert对话框

    IE的alert没有标题,如果是做企业系统的话,弹出来的的感觉不是很好,所以自己找了一下国外有没有做好的,经过1个小时的奋斗,找到一个不错的,自己重写整理了一下 下载地址如下:http://downl ...

  2. Btrace的使用方法

    本文基于<深入理解Java虚拟机:JVM高级特性与最佳实践 第2版> 写在前面: Btrace有很多用法,比如说性能监视,连接泄露,内存泄漏,多线程竞争,而本文说的只是最基本的应用打印调用 ...

  3. Easyui Datagrid相同连续列合Demo之三

    效果图: html <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> < ...

  4. windows2003 iis6.0站点打不开,找不到服务器或 DNS 错误【转】

    最近服务器经常出现打不开网站的现象,有时出现在上午,有时出现在中午,几乎天天都会出现一次,出现问题时,无论是回收程序池还是重启IIS或者关闭其它一些可能有影响的服务,都不能解决问题.网站打不开时,有如 ...

  5. TMS320C64x DSP L1 L2 Cache架构(1)——C64x Cache Architecture

    [前沿]研究生阶段从事于DSP和FPGA技术的相关研究工作,学习并整理了大量的技术资料,包括TI公司的官方文档和网络上的详细笔记,花费了大量的时间和精力总结了前人的工作成果.无奈工作却从事于嵌入式技术 ...

  6. BT下载会损害硬盘吗

    简而言之,这个问题是否存在,取决于网络带宽的发展速度与硬件性能的发展速度.如果硬件发展的速度快, 网络带宽速度发展慢,那么对大多数人而言,当前的硬件在慢速的带宽下载BT不会造成任何的硬盘损坏.     ...

  7. 用 HTML5+ payment方法支付宝支付遇到的坑

    用 HTML5+ payment方法碰到的第一个坑就是如果是支付宝的话签约那种支付方式. 因为 Dcloud的文档没有更新的原因你可以看到他们说的都是‘移动支付’,但是你去支付宝平台的时候看到的根本就 ...

  8. hdu 2918(IDA*)

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2918 思路:这道题与前面几道类似,可以说是被秒杀了!!!构造启发式函数h()=(cnt+3)/4(cn ...

  9. jboss eap 6.4 部署 从weblogic迁移

    从weblogic10.3像jboss 6.4项目迁移,遇到的一些问题: 因为使用weblogic可以自定义公共的war包库,在使用jboss中,也采取项目依赖公共库的方式: 1.jboss中使用公共 ...

  10. Spring_day02--课程安排_Spring的bean管理(注解)(注解创建对象/注入属性、配置文件和注解混合使用)

    Spring_day02 上节内容回顾 今天内容介绍 Spring的bean管理(注解) 注解介绍 Spring注解开发准备 注解创建对象 注解注入属性 配置文件和注解混合使用 AOP概念 AOP原理 ...